Members raggety Posted May 21, 2005 Members Share Posted May 21, 2005 Concept #7 - Using The Simple Map To use the map, remember two things. First, you may jump anywhere from I. Second, if a chord appears at more than one place, there is an "imaginary tunnel" connecting both spots, so you can move from one to the other. Got it? With the map you can do exercises like: 1. Write a long "loop," starting with the I chord, Jump from I to wherever you like. Then work your way back to I by following the arrows. 2. Write several three or four chord sequences. Start anywhere on the map. Follow the arrows. Here are some possible answers. I - iii - vi - IV - ii - V - I is a "loop." It starts and ends on I. IV - V - I is a three chord sequence. vi - ii - V - I is a four chord sequence. ii - V - iii - vi is another.
